The cheapest way to get from Sitges to Oliva is to bus which costs €30 - €70 and takes 8h 17m.
The fastest way to get from Sitges to Oliva is to drive which takes 3h 53m and costs €60 - €90.
The distance between Sitges and Oliva is 472 km. The road distance is 391.9 km.
The best way to get from Sitges to Oliva without a car is to train via Barcelona which takes 7h 44m and costs €45 - €110.
It takes approximately 7h 44m to get from Sitges to Oliva, including transfers.
The best way to get from Sitges to Oliva is to train via Barcelona which takes 7h 44m and costs €45 - €110. Alternatively, you can bus, which costs €30 - €70 and takes 8h 17m.
Yes, the driving distance between Sitges to Oliva is 392 km. It takes approximately 3h 53m to drive from Sitges to Oliva.
